Alibaba-NLP CORE: boosting compositional reasoning in MLLM embeddings via reranker distillation
Alibaba-NLP · hf · 2026-09-04
Alibaba-NLP introduces CORE, an approach to improve compositional reasoning in MLLM embeddings.
- Method: distills compositional ranking judgments from a cross-attentive reranker into an embedding model
- Training uses synthesized multi-level candidates and a Rank-KL objective
- Result: improves compositional retrieval without degrading standard retrieval performance
